P.J. O’Rourke says we’ve worked ourselves into a state of anger and perplexity, and it’s no surprise because perplexed and angry is what America has always been all about. This uproarious look at the current state of the United States includes essays like ‘The New Puritanism – and Welcome to It,’ about the upside of being ‘woke’ (and unable to get back to sleep); ‘Sympathy vs. Empathy,’ which considers whether it’s better to have an idea of how people feel or to bust their skulls to get inside their heads; ‘A Brief Digression on the Additional Hell of the Internet of Things’ because your juicer is sending fake news to your FitBit about what’s in your refrigerator; and many more. A couple of extra perks include a quiz to determine where you stand on the spectrum of ‘Coastals vs. Heartlanders’ and a ‘An Inauguration Speech I’d Like To Hear:’ ask not what your country can do for you.
